I've succumed to the website paranoia and failure mentality.
In the last couple of months I've noticed my idle speed on startup from cold, seemed to have dropped to 5-600 revs, when warm would be 6-700.
Checking all relevant posts etc in the last 6 months history, I was convinced that the least of my problems would be valve clearances needing adjusted etc.
Car's been gone for 2 days for checkup and has been given a clean bill of health, all but 2 valves are spot on whilst the rouge 2 are less than a thou out. Idle screw needed slight adjustment, in hindsight I'm still glad I done it for my piece of mind, even although the car has been running lovely, I had a niggly worry given what others had experienced.

What can we do to stop this kinda thinking? whatever my bill comes to, the £'s could've been better spent on Grape juice and keep me away from that Gripe juice that settles my worries and indigestion.
